2009 Accomplishments:

  • Provided overall project management and facilitation of the first Green Demolition in ABC’s Extreme Makeover: Home Edition’s five year history. The effort mobilized 150 volunteers and as a result, we were able to dismantle the Powell Family’s 2.5 story, 3,300 square foot house in 15 hours and achieve a 97% material diversion rate (by weight).
  • Streamlined our strategy of Green Demolition to maximize reclamation of materials. To date, we’ve successfully completed over 45 projects, diverting hundreds of tons of material from the landfill.
  • Began a partnership with Kaleida Health to dismantle multiple residential structures on the site of their planned Senior Living Facility in the heart of Buffalo’s downtown medical corridor.
  • Multiplied our relationships with demolition contractors in the City of Buffalo to conduct pre-demolition salvage; this increases our inventory of reclaimed materials; our Salvage truck is running seven days a week.
  • Piloted our ReACT! community partners program, through a partnership with HSBC BANK and Rebuilding Together; mobilizing 65 local HSBC volunteers and a financial investment for east side target neighborhood.
  • Recruited over 600 volunteers throughout the year to work at the ReSource and in the neighborhood.
  • Secured more than 250 volunteers to plant over 700 trees with Re-Tree WNY, increasing the property value of the 30 blocks surrounding The ReSource and contributing to cleaner air and positive neighborhood morale.
  • Collaborated with Grassroots Gardens to reduce blight on over 20 vacant lots across the city. Working under a grant from The Community Foundation for Greater Buffalo we were able to facilitate installation of 12 vegetable gardens including a Children’s Vinery, a tree farm, strawberry lots and a blueberry grove.
  • Provided 2,500 hours of Service Learning opportunities and project leadership in the historic Cold Spring and Masten neighborhoods through a partnership with City Honors High School and Senior Class of 2009. Additionally, we provided a supervised work and career development experience for six high school students enrolled in the Buffalo Employment and Training Center Summer Employment Program.
  • Developed our brand in Western New York to expand our customer base and increased weekly sales by 100% since last year at this time, with sales still increasing! The ReSource continues to function as the critical component in achieving financial self-sustainability for our core programs.
  • Enhanced our operating infrastructure and capacity at the ReSource by implementing a point of sale and reporting system; increased available square footage for retail use by nearly 2,000 square feet; the store is now open 6 days a week.
  • Broadened our support base and enlarged our membership from 40 to over 120 members.
